REMBRANDT HARMENSZ. VAN RIJN (1606-1669)
Young Man in a Velvet Cap (Petrus Sylvius?)
etching with drypoint, 1637, on laid paper, a good but slightly later impression of the second, final state, beginning to show some wear, with small margins
Plate 96 x 84 mm.
Sheet 104 x 88 mm.
Provenance
With Kennedy Galleries, New York (their stock number a45922 in pencil verso).
Sir Byron Edmund Walker (1848-1924), Toronto.
Art Gallery of Ontario, Toronto, inventory number 1676 (with their labels and deaccession stamp on the mount); bequeathed by the above and received in 1926.
Literature
Bartsch, Hollstein 268; Hind 151; New Hollstein 164
